Konjō Blue Color

#003171

Konjō Blue is deep, cool-toned shade of blue cyan. It is better contrasting with white. This color combines beautifully with orange, mid green or red magenta

Complementary Palette

#713f00 is the best complementary color to Konjō Blue. Orange shades generally complement the blue cyan hues best as they are found on the opposite end of the color wheel. The most popular #003171 complementary color is Cinnamon, as it offers maximum contrast and grab the viewer's attention.

Analogous Palette

The analogous palette of mid cyan, blue cyan, and mid blue colors offers a soft combination of similar cool shades. The analogous colors of Midnight Blue are #006971 and #070071. Thus found on the left and right of #003171 on the color wheel with a 30° gap. Consider matching Mosque and Navy Blue colors as they work well with Konjō Blue.

Split-complementary Palette

The split-complementary Konjō Blue palette consists of #697100 and #710700 colors. They can be found 30° apart on either side of the complementary color (#713f00). Try Olive and Lonestar colors in combination with #003171, as they are not as contrasting as a complementary color, hence, giving more hue variety to make your design stand out.

Triadic Palette

The triadic palette of #003171 offers a combination of yellow green and red magenta shades and equally high contrast between the three of them. Find triadic colors at the 120° distance from the Konjō Blue. Thus Verdun Green and Siren giving maximum hue separation to use all three together.

Square Palette

The square color palette of Konjō Blue contains three additional colors. Thus, complementary Cinnamon, Pompadour, and Camarone split by 90° on the color wheel. #003171 square combo is a palette of blue cyan, mid magenta, orange and mid green shades that work together well.

Conversion Table

In a RGB color space, hex #003171 is made of 0% red, 30% green and 70% blue. In a HSL mode Konjō Blue has a hue angle of 213.98°,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 22.16%. In a CMYK space (used in printing only), hex #003171 is made of 44.31% cyan, 25.09% magenta, 0% yellow and 55.69% black ink.
